Key takeaways
Optimize product titles, descriptions, and keywords for each target language and culture to improve searchability and resonance with local buyers.
Understand and adapt to cultural nuances in marketing and sales to build brand trust and credibility in foreign markets.
Prioritize customer support strategies tailored for international buyers, addressing language and cultural communication differences.
Leverage tools and resources for effective localization to streamline the process of adapting product content and customer interactions.
Identify high-potential international markets through thorough market research to ensure a strategic and profitable expansion.
